How does cron decide whom the email will send to?
I know setting MAILTO is effective for individual crontab jobs, since the
whole cron job will be run under a single user id. But how about the cron
jobs under /etc/cron.d/?
I know normally cron will send emails to whoever the job is owned/
launched by, but if I put a MAILTO at the top of the file, will all
emails be then sent to my designated MAILTO user id, instead of to
different users that own/launch the jobs?
